BOXING.

idee. Tel. Copyrigut—United Press Assn.l iAustraban and N Z cable Association.) LONDON, Alarcli 30. Lucas states that Albert Lloyd is willing to accept Nillea’ challenge to box at Paris

SYDNEY, April l. At the Stadium, Menzies knocked out Les Waters in the fifteenth round, the , winner securing a convincing victory. Waters was badly used up, and required medical attention. SYDNEY, April 2. Stewart and _ Jack C'ole fought a draw for the (middleweight championship of Australia. , ’ K. ~ .;AIELBUfe'RNE, April 1. Grime knocked out George Storey in theithird royind.'. The.winner was too fast’and clever for his opponent.

v ’ CHRISTCHURCH, April 1. At King Edwai’d Barracks last night Flynn (Auckland) defeated Gunn (Timaru) for the feather-weight championship of Neiv Zealand and a purse of £125. Flynn held the advantage up to tho ninth round and sent his opponent to the boards several times. The referee stopped the fight. The amateur bouts resulted as follows : Thompson (Christchurch), defeated Nelson (Greymuuth); Pengelly beat N. Moulin; and Howell beat Ennis. Much interest centres in the AlcCleary—Cadman contest nightCHRISTCHURCH, last night, There was a big crowd at the King Edivard Bu'iracks to-night to sec the fight between Brian ATcCleary and Lawric Cadman fo'r the professional light heavyweight championship and a purse of £2OO. Tho fight lasted seven rounds, when Cadman's seconds threw in the towel. Cadman was then absolutely done.
